Hairpins

mother’s hairpins wait
patiently 
in worn, loose clumps
for her to pick through and use
over and over, night after night

it seems to be the same
she, by the bathroom counter
day after day
twirling her fine, grey hair
around thin, frail fingers 

and so expertly done, too
without a thought
her dim eyes stare
into a dim mirror that reflects
her lined, aging face
once young and beautiful

she creates curls
as she stands
alone
